It’s official — our favorite runDisney event is coming back to EPCOT! The 2026 Disney Wine & Dine Half Marathon Weekend will run from Thursday, October 22nd, to Sunday, October 25th. Here’s everything you need to know!

The 2026 Disney Wine & Dine Half Marathon Weekend will bring back the 5K, 10K, Half Marathon, and Two Course Challenge. The races will include exclusive character meet-and-greets and tons of photo opportunities. And we can’t forget about our favorite tradition, the Post-Race Party.
The 2026 Disney Wine & Dine Half Marathon Weekend 5K marathon will be held on Friday, October 23, at 4:30 AM. The 3.1-mile course through Walt Disney World Resort will be The Aristocats themed!

It will feature an array of Disney character sightings and entertainment, on-course and post-race refreshments, including the Crème de la Crème à la Edgar beverage and Pastry Crackers in France. Upon completion, racers will get a 5K Finisher Medal and a participant shirt.

For the 10K on Saturday, October 24th, racers will arrive at 4:30 AM for a 6.2-mile fiesta hosted by the Three Caballeros! The race will include an array of Disney character sightings and entertainment, and on-course and post-race refreshments, including tamales in Mexico. Finishers will receive a 10K Finisher Medal and a participant shirt.

For the Half Marathon on Sunday, October 25th at 5 AM, get ready for a supercalifragilisticexpialidocious day hosted by Mary Poppins! The 13.1-mile course through Walt Disney World Resort will include an array of Disney character sightings and entertainment throughout the race, in addition to on-course and post-race refreshments.

Finishers will receive a Half Marathon Finisher Medal, a participant shirt, a free $15 Disney Promo Card, and After-Hours access to a post-race party at EPCOT International Food & Wine Festival.

The Disney Wine & Dine Challenge is 19.3 miles (made up of the 10K and the half marathon), hosted by Grumpy! The race will have an array of Disney character sightings and entertainment, and on-course and post-race refreshments, including pretzels in Germany.

It will also include a participant shirt, a $15 Disney Promo Card, and After-Hours access to a Post-Race Party at EPCOT International Food & Wine Festival. Complete both the 10K and Half Marathon races on pace and earn a Disney Wine & Dine 10K Medal, a Disney Wine & Dine Half Marathon Medal, and another Disney Two Course Challenge Medal. That’s three medals total!

To register, Club runDisney Gold and Platinum Registration opens February 3rd, 2026. General Registration opens February 10th, 2026, at 10 AM ET. We’re so excited to participate this year. Stay tuned to All Ears for more 2026 Disney Wine & Dine Half Marathon Weekend news!
